Analysis of generalized bilinear systems. Application to diagnosis
Abstract
In this survey, the authors try to summarize the various aspects of data reconciliation, to point out the main difficulties and to present the state of the art in this field specially for systems described by generalized bilinear models. In parctice, these models are used to describe conservation of material in total flow and partial flows for different chemical or minerallurgical species. The authors present the steps of the data reconciliation problem in the following order; techniques of data reconciliation, classification of the data by the observability concept, gross error detection and localisation, variance of measurement error estimation, sensor positioning.
